For just about any job, your fingers are one of the most important parts of your body for you to keep in good shape – but if you work a desk job, you might not think about the possibility of your fingers getting hurt until it actually starts to happen! Rather than waiting until your fingers get hurt (and then trying to figure out how to make them feel better!), you will be better served making sure you know how to protect your fingers from cramps, pain, and downright injuries from the start!
Rest: When you get into a groove on a project, it can be easy to just keep typing and typing, but if you do this, you will open up the possibility of your fingers getting hurt from all the constant work. You should give your hand a break every fifteen or twenty minutes (at least), and while you are resting your hands, you should let them hang down at your side as you shake them out a bit. Equipment: The equipment you are doing your typing on will also factor into the way your fingers feel, as keyboards (especially those on a laptop) can put your fingers in a cramped position, which can cause them to start experiencing pain. Pace: Because work is “work,” it is not unusual for you to start working at a really fast pace, trying to finish up all of your projects as quickly as you can so that you can be done with “work.” But you should keep your pace in mind, as a steady, leisurely pace of typing will feel a lot better on your fingers in the long run than a rushed, aggressive pace.
